1. 什么是区块链技术?

区块链是一种去中心化的分布式账本技术,通过将数据以区块的形式链接在一起,形成一个不可篡改的数据库。它没有中央机构来控制交易和数据的存储,而是由全网用户共同维护。

2. 区块链如何保护数字币的安全?

区块链通过以下措施保护数字币的安全:

- 去中心化存储:数字币的交易数据不存储在一个中央机构,而是分布在所有用户的计算机上,提高了安全性。

- 分布式共识机制:区块链利用共识算法,如工作量证明(Proof-of-Work)或权益证明(Proof-of-Stake),确保交易的真实性和一致性。

- 加密存储:区块链中的数据都被加密存储,保护了数字币的交易信息不被篡改或泄露。

- 不可篡改性:区块链的数据一旦被写入,就无法被修改,确保数字币交易的安全。

3. 区块链中使用了哪些加密算法?

区块链中使用了多种加密算法来保护数字币的安全,常见的有:

- 非对称加密算法:如RSA算法、椭圆曲线加密算法(ECC),用于数字币的账户密钥管理。

- 哈希函数:如SHA-256、SHA-3等,用于验证区块数据的完整性。

- 对称加密算法:如AES算法,用于保护数字币的交易数据传输安全。

4. 区块链技术面临哪些安全威胁?

区块链技术也存在一些安全威胁,例如:

- 51%攻击:当某一组织或个人掌握超过区块链网络算力的51%时,他们可能会篡改交易信息。

- 双重支付:攻击者可以通过在区块链网络中提交两笔相同的交易来欺骗系统,获得不当利益。

- 智能合约漏洞:智能合约代码的缺陷可能被黑客利用,导致数字币被盗或交易执行异常。

5. 区块链的去中心化特性如何保护数字币安全?

区块链的去中心化特性使得数字币的交易数据不依赖于单一的中央机构,这样能够降低被攻击和篡改的风险。没有单一的控制点,使得攻击者难以集中攻击,并且交易记录的分布在全网,保证了数据的可信性。

6. 区块链是否可以防止数字币被盗?

区块链本身并不能完全防止数字币被盗,但它提供了一定的安全保护,使得数字币的交易更加安全。例如,区块链的加密存储和不可篡改性可以防止交易数据被篡改,分布式的共识机制可以确保交易的真实性。

7. 区块链技术如何应对未来的安全挑战?

为了应对未来的安全挑战,区块链技术需要不断改进和演进。例如,引入更加复杂的共识算法、加密算法的安全性、加强智能合约审计和安全性测试等。此外,加强用户教育和意识提高认识也是防范安全风险的重要举措。